Output 0739665113ab19284617bf6d81bda42e92ddc5866eb30e73b8ae3deb668f4b1e:1

value
2725314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1dc5afcd4cb6daa581c1eeace7a6ee59544572 OP_EQUAL
address
32tNNeVXWbyamPCbkAGH6Qn6S5xvHUCQSa
transaction
0739665113ab19284617bf6d81bda42e92ddc5866eb30e73b8ae3deb668f4b1e
confirmations
305022
spent
true